Group Structure
Corporate ownership hierarchy and control relationships
3 Parents 597 Subsidiaries
Parent Companies
| Company Name | Company ID | Country | Ownership | |
|---|---|---|---|---|
| OCTOPUS INVESTMENTS LIMITED | UK-03942880 | united kingdom | 75-100% | |
| OCTOPUS CAPITAL LIMITED | UK-03981143 | united kingdom | 75-100% | |
| OCTOPUS GROUP HOLDINGS LTD | UK-14002583 | united kingdom | 75-100% |
OCTOPUS INVESTMENTS NOMINEES LIMITED
UK-05572093
Subsidiary Companies
| Company Name | Company ID | Country | Ownership | Depth | |
|---|---|---|---|---|---|
| CHILLINGHAM POWER LIMITED | UK-08840778 | united kingdom | 75-100% | Level 1 | |
| ECREBO LIMITED | UK-07013775 | united kingdom | - | Level 1 | |
| FERN TRADING LIMITED +3 | UK-12601636 | united kingdom | - | Level 1 | |
| FOREMAN TRADING LIMITED +2 | UK-06173997 | united kingdom | 75-100% | Level 1 | |
| MICHELSON DIAGNOSTICS LTD +1 | UK-05732681 | united kingdom | - | Level 1 | |
| OCTOPUS RENEWABLES INFRASTRUCTURE TRUST PLC +1 | UK-12257608 | united kingdom | 75-100% | Level 1 | |
| SPINNEY SERVICES LIMITED +1 | UK-05861696 | united kingdom | 75-100% | Level 1 | |
| TICKETUS HOLDINGS 5 LIMITED +2 | UK-06444705 | united kingdom | 75-100% | Level 1 | |
| TICKETUS SERVICES 6 LIMITED +1 | UK-06786816 | united kingdom | 75-100% | Level 1 | |
| TM TRADING LIMITED +156 | UK-07447367 | united kingdom | 75-100% | Level 1 |
